Сварочный инструмент совершает ультразвуковые колебани в двух плоскост х: перпендикул рно и параллельно движению свариваемых материалов, что и обеспечивает повышение прочности сварного шва и его качества. 4 ил.The invention relates to the welding of plastics, in particular to devices for continuous ultrasonic welding. The goal is to increase the strength and quality of the weld. For this, the device is equipped with a magnetostrictive transducer 1, an elastic vibration transformer 2, a welded tool including a first hollow truncated cone 3 of bending vibrations and an additional hollow truncated cone 4 of longitudinal vibrations connected through a ring welding tip 5, the central rod element 6 of longitudinal vibrations that hollow truncated cones 3 and 4 along planes of smaller diameter 7 and 8. In this case, the height of the first truncated cone is equal to or a multiple of 4 of the length of the longitudinal wave, its height is equal to or a multiple of 1/2 the wavelength of the flexural vibrations, and the height of the side surface of the additional hollow truncated cone is equal to or a multiple of 1/4 of the flexural wavelength and its height is equal to or a multiple of 1/2 the wavelength of the longitudinal vibrations, and the length of the central rod is equal to or multiple of 1/2 wavelength of longitudinal oscillations. The welding tool performs ultrasonic oscillations in two planes: perpendicular and parallel to the movement of the materials to be welded, which ensures an increase in the strength of the weld and its quality. 4 il.
